Choosing The Perfect Color Palette

Choosing the right colors sets the mood for your master bedroom. Colors can make the room feel calm, bright, or cozy.

Think about how you want to feel in your space. This helps you pick colors that match your style and comfort.

Calming Neutrals

Neutral colors create a peaceful and relaxing bedroom. Shades like beige, soft gray, and cream work well.

They make the room feel open and can match many types of furniture and decor.

  • Use light colors on walls for a bright look
  • Add texture with rugs and pillows in similar tones
  • Keep furniture colors natural or white

Bold Accent Colors

Adding bold colors gives your bedroom energy and style. Use colors like deep blue, emerald green, or rich red.

Use these colors in small amounts so they do not overwhelm the space.

  • Paint one wall with a bold color as an accent
  • Choose colorful pillows or curtains
  • Add artwork or decor in bright shades

Monochrome Schemes

Monochrome uses different shades of one color. This creates a clean and stylish look.

Try using light and dark tones of blue, gray, or green for a balanced feel.

  • Mix fabrics and patterns in the same color family
  • Use light colors on walls and darker tones on furniture
  • Add metal or wood accents to add interest

Lighting To Set The Mood

Lighting plays a key role in creating a relaxing atmosphere in your bedroom. The right lights help you feel calm and comfortable.

Choosing different types of lighting lets you change the mood for different times and activities in your room.

Ambient Lighting

Ambient lighting gives a soft, general light that fills the whole room. It sets the base mood and makes the space feel warm.

Use ceiling lights, wall-mounted fixtures, or large lamps to create even light. Choose bulbs with warm colors to add coziness.

Task Lighting

Task lighting focuses on areas where you do specific activities. It helps you see clearly while reading, dressing, or working.

  • Bedside lamps for reading
  • Desk lamps for work or hobbies
  • Vanity lights for dressing and makeup

Accent Lighting

Accent lighting highlights special features in your bedroom. It adds depth and interest by drawing attention to objects or areas.

TypeUse
SpotlightsShow artwork or photos
LED stripsLight shelves or under bed
Wall sconcesFrame mirrors or plants

Incorporating Textiles And Rugs

Textiles and rugs add warmth and style to a bedroom. They make the space feel cozy and inviting.

Choosing the right fabrics and floor coverings can change the room’s look and comfort. Let’s explore key areas to focus on.

Bedding Choices

Pick bedding made from soft, breathable fabrics. Cotton and linen work well for comfort and durability.

  • Use layers of blankets and throws for texture
  • Choose colors that match or contrast with the room
  • Select pillowcases with different patterns for interest

Curtains And Drapes

Curtains help control light and add softness to the walls. Heavier drapes block noise and cold drafts.

Fabric TypeBest UseCare
SheerLight filteringMachine wash gentle
VelvetDarkening and insulationDry clean only
LinenCasual lookMachine wash cold

Area Rugs

Area rugs add color and comfort underfoot. They also define spaces in the room.

Consider these tips for choosing rugs:

  • Pick sizes that fit the furniture layout
  • Choose materials like wool for softness and durability
  • Use patterns to add character or keep it simple with solids

Maximizing Storage Solutions

Keeping a bedroom tidy feels easier with smart storage ideas. You can save space and keep things neat by using clever storage options.

This guide covers built-in closets, under-bed storage, and furniture that works in many ways.

Built-in Closets

Built-in closets fit into walls and use space well. They offer room for clothes, shoes, and accessories without taking extra floor space.

Adding shelves and drawers inside helps organize items better.

Under-bed Storage

The space under your bed is great for storing things you don’t use daily. Use boxes, drawers, or bags to keep this area tidy.

  • Plastic bins with lids protect from dust
  • Rolling drawers make access easy
  • Vacuum bags save space for clothes
  • Use shallow trays for shoes or books

Multi-functional Furniture

Furniture that serves more than one purpose saves room and adds storage. Examples include beds with drawers or benches with hidden compartments.

Furniture TypeStorage FeatureBenefits
Storage BedBuilt-in drawersStores clothes and bedding
Ottoman BenchHidden compartmentHolds blankets or pillows
NightstandOpen shelves or drawersKeeps books and small items
